Christ Church
Christ Church is the oldest Protestant Church in the Middle East. It was completed in Jerusalem in 1849 and soon after became known as the "Jewish Protestant Church." When writing about the establishment of the church, well known historian Stephen Neil called it "one of the strangest episodes of modern church history."

Beit Immanuel
Located in a spacious and picturesque, mid-18th Century structure that once served as the glittering Baron’s Palace—home to actor Peter Ustinov’s Grandfather—Beit Immanuel was first occupied by CMJ pioneers dedicated to the return of the Jewish people to the land of Israel and the restoration and proclamation of the Messianic Jewish hope in Yeshua.

Partner Schools
At Mekor HaTikvah School in Jerusalem, students are learning standard subjects such as mathematics, history and art—all taught in Hebrew.
They are also learning to love, honor and obey Yeshua in every aspect of their lives. Mekor HaTikvah, which means “source of hope,” is a rapidly-growing Messianic primary and middle school, the only Messianic school in Jerusalem and one of only two in Israel. Both are supported by CMJ.
